
Core Components is adding a LAN Game Center!
The new game center will be called The Game Core. It will consist of 12 gaming computers initially with the possibility of expansion to as many 21. All computers will be offering the lastest hardware from Intel, Nvidia, Corsair and more. Each system will be designed, assembled, and tested by our own in-house Gaming Computer brand - DarkWorx. Gaming keyboards, mice and headset from Razer. You can expect a game library over 200 titles strong including many popular titles such as Battlefield Bad Company 2, StarCraft 2, and World of Warcraft.
What is a LAN Game Center? For those that aren't gamers, or are just not familiar with the idea...
"LAN Game Center" - A LAN Gaming Center is a business where one can use a computer connected over a local area network (LAN) to other computers, primarily for the purpose of playing multiplayer video games. Use of these computers costs a fee, usually per hour or sometimes one can have unmetered access with a pass for a day or month, etc.
